Job description

Our client a publicly-traded company is looking for a BILINGUAL assistant controller that will be involved in every piece of the accounting cycle. As the assistant controller, you will be involved in the daily accounting tasks, the monthly forecasting, the annual budget, and many other great tasks. If you have good communication skills, are solutions-minded, and not afraid to get hands-on. Then this is for you.


Advantages
Salary in line with your experience + benefits + bonus + stock purchase plan
2 -3 weeks’ vacation
Work on-site required (Gatineau a must)


Responsibilities
Responsible for the monthly financial close function and the preparation of the financial statements
Responsible for the GL reconciliation
Analysis of the monthly projections
Explanations of budget variance analysis
Participate and plan the annual financial budget exercise
Overseas the capital purchase process
Implement and maintain required internal controls
Implement and maintain regular reporting processes to support operations
Coordinate and perform Inventory counts
Disseminate the necessary information to maintain proper internal control compliance and accounting procedures and facilitate financial performance review with other departments


Qualifications
Min. 2 years experience in a similar role
Good communication skills in French and English, as you will be speaking with clients and colleagues in Ontario and Quebec
Strong knowledge of Microsoft Excel
Experience in a manufacturing or production environment is an asset
Comfortable working in a fast-paced, environment
Bachelor’s degree in accounting or equivalent,
CPA or CPA Candidat an asset
